Work the deliverables board covers the columns and dragging. This is what you can do with a card itself β€” its menu, what it shows, and working several at once.

The card menu

Right-click a card to open its menu:

  • Edit β€” opens the same side panel as clicking the card.
  • Duplicate β€” creates a copy titled "<title> (Copy)", carrying over the video type, duration, priority, subtitles/motion-graphics flags and status, placed at the end of the board.
  • Open Frame.io β€” appears once the deliverable has a review link, and opens it in a new tab.
  • Archive / Unarchive β€” archiving sets the card aside; unarchiving returns it to whichever status it was in right before you archived it, not a fixed default.
  • Delete β€” asks for confirmation first. This cannot be undone.

Choosing what a card shows

The Fields button above the board (the eye icon) opens a searchable list of everything a card can display: Priority, Video type, Planned date, Due date, Duration, Export specs, Subtitles badge, Motion graphics badge and Script excerpt. Toggle any of them off to declutter a busy board. This is a board-wide setting saved on the project, not a personal preference β€” everyone looking at this project's board sees the same fields.

Selecting more than one

Cmd/Ctrl-click a card to select it; click more cards to add them. A floating bar appears at the bottom of the screen showing the count, with Edit Selected, Delete Selected and an βœ• to clear the selection.

With cards selected, dragging any one of them moves the whole group to the new column together β€” a fast way to advance a batch that finished a stage at the same time.

Bulk edit

Edit Selected opens the same fields as adding a deliverable β€” title, video type, duration, priority, resolution, aspect ratios, fps, music, subtitles/motion graphics and due date β€” and applies whatever you change to every selected card in one save. Handy for retagging a whole shoot's worth of deliverables β€” new due date, new priority β€” without opening each one.

Delete Selected deletes every selected card after one confirmation. Also irreversible.
